/*
Template for evaluator in EO, a functor that computes the fitness of an EO
==========================================================================
*/
#ifndef _eoMyStructEvalFunc_h
#define _eoMyStructEvalFunc_h
// include whatever general include you need
#include <stdexcept>
#include <fstream>
// include the base definition of eoEvalFunc
#include "eoEvalFunc.h"
/**
Always write a comment in this format before class definition
if you want the class to be documented by Doxygen
*/
template <class EOT>
class eoMyStructEvalFunc : public eoEvalFunc<EOT>
{
public:
/// Ctor - no requirement
// START eventually add or modify the anyVariable argument
eoMyStructEvalFunc()
// eoMyStructEvalFunc( varType _anyVariable) : anyVariable(_anyVariable)
// END eventually add or modify the anyVariable argument
{
// START Code of Ctor of an eoMyStructEvalFunc object
// END Code of Ctor of an eoMyStructEvalFunc object
}
/** Actually compute the fitness
*
* @param EOT & _eo the EO object to evaluate
* it should stay templatized to be usable
* with any fitness type
*/
void operator()(EOT & _eo)
{
// test for invalid to avoid recomputing fitness of unmodified individuals
if (_eo.invalid())
{
double fit; // to hold fitness value
// START Code of computation of fitness of the eoMyStruct object
// fit = blablabla
// END Code of computation of fitness of the eoMyStruct object
_eo.fitness(fit);
}
}
private:
// START Private data of an eoMyStructEvalFunc object
// varType anyVariable; // for example ...
// END Private data of an eoMyStructEvalFunc object
};
#endif
